Filipino Maids Flee Kuwait After Domestic Worker Killed
Local media reported that 114 Filipino maids had left Kuwait in less than four days following the brutal killing of a 35-year-old Filipino domestic worker.
A tragic incident has prompted the Philippine government to suspend Kuwait's foreign recruitment agencies' accreditation.
In the Philippines, the Ministry of Migrant Labour has announced that Kuwaiti recruitment offices will be added to the blacklist, making Filipino workers unable to work in Kuwait.
A 35-year-old Filipina housemaid was allegedly murdered by a teenager after being sexually assaulted. Burned and with a smashed head, the victim's body was found on Salmi Road.
Within 24 hours of receiving reports of the discovery, the Ministry of Interior launched an investigation. A 17-year-old Kuwaiti suspect was accused of raping and killing the housemaid, burning her body, and leaving it on the side of the road.
During the autopsy, it was revealed that the victim was pregnant, with samples matching the suspect's. Sponsors reported that the victim had absconded.
The Kuwaiti Public Prosecution has taken legal action against the young man, who allegedly admitted to committing the crime.
Kuwait's government allowed the body to be released and shipped back to the Philippines.
The victim, who had four children arrived in Kuwait in July 2022 and worked as a household service worker for a family in Jahra. According to her death certificate from Kuwait Ministry of Health, Forensic Department, she suffered fractures to her skull, face, lower jaw, and brain, resulting in her death.
